WebCharged account holders without authorization: Children and other users who play Fortnite can purchase in-game content such as cosmetics and battle passes using Fortnite’s V-Bucks. Up until 2024, Epic allowed children to purchase V-Bucks by simply pressing buttons without requiring any parental or card holder action or consent. WebDec 19, 2024 · The FTC’s. The FTC’s $275 million proposed settlement with Epic Games, owner of Fortnite, alleges the company violated the law by collecting personal information from kids under 13 without parental consent and by enabling voice and text chat by default – an unfair practice that put kids and teens in risky contact with strangers.But to borrow a …
